Deere Loader Glitch: Understanding and Resolving Float Detent and Hydraulic Glitches
#1
What Is the Float Detent—and Why It Matters
The float position is a loader control setting that disengages hydraulic force, allowing the bucket or arms to contour to the ground under their own weight. A detent is a small notch or mechanism—either in the joystick or valve—that helps hold the control in float position. When this detent fails, the loader may not float properly, leading to jerky movement or failure to settle smoothly.

Terminology Explained
  • Float Detent: A mechanism that holds the loader control in float mode.
  • Control Valve Detent: The actual notch or catch is in the valve assembly—not always in the joystick.
  • Hydraulic Levers and Joysticks: Input devices that engage or release hydraulics; their mechanical play or adjustment can influence operation.
  • Hydraulic Float Function: Mode where loader arms descend freely, guided by weight instead of hydraulic pressure.

Common Float-Related Loader Issues
  • Float Doesn’t Engage
    • Control lever moves freely but won’t activate float mode. Could require valve detent kit or joystick adjustment.
  • Float Activates But Doesn’t Hold
    • Loader enters float but immediately reverts to neutral. Likely a worn or weak detent mechanism.
  • Joystick Feels Loose or Sticky
    • Excessive play or stiffness in the joystick may be felt but the real issue might be deeper in the valve.

Troubleshooting Checklist
  • Test Float Activation: With the bucket a couple inches above ground, push joystick fully forward. Does the loader settle—or resist?
  • Check Holding: Keep joystick forward—does it return to neutral on its own? That indicates a detent that won’t hold.
  • Joystick Movement vs. Valve Action: If all other loader functions work fine, the joystick is likely not the root cause—turn your attention to the valve.
  • Detent Repair Kit: A modest investment—often under $100—can fix float-holding issues and save big repair bills downstream.

Suggested Repair Steps
  • Begin with simple movements and observe whether float engages and holds.
  • If float works but doesn’t stay—order a valve detent kit; it typically includes springs, notched mechanism, and seals.
  • If joystick feels sloppy or unresponsive, check for linkage play, but don’t ignore valve-side components.
  • After installation, test float again under load—fully forward, let bucket settle, then pull back. It should stay until actively moved out of float.

Conclusion
Loader float issues—whether not engaging or failing to hold—often trace back to subtle detent wear inside the valve. Rather than assume joystick failure or worse hydraulic glitch, tackle the valve detent first. A simple repair kit can restore smooth operation and save both time and money.
